Overview¶
Relier provides a RESTful API for mobile airtime top-ups in Mexico. This document outlines the integration process for HAZ Group to connect to the Relier platform.
API Features¶
- Real-time top-ups to major Mexican carriers (Telcel, Movistar, AT&T, Unefon, Virgin Mobile)
- USD billing with automatic MXN conversion at competitive exchange rates
- Transaction tracking with unique IDs for reconciliation
- High availability with 99.9% uptime SLA
- Secure authentication with API keys
- Rate limiting to prevent abuse

Transaction Statuses:
- PENDING - Transaction submitted, awaiting processing
- SUCCESS - Top-up completed successfully
- FAILED - Top-up failed (balance will not be deducted)
Request/Response Format¶
Request Requirements¶
- Content-Type: All POST requests must use
Content-Type: application/json - Phone Format: 10 digits, no spaces or special characters (e.g.,
5566374683) - Amount: Must be one of the allowed MXN amounts (10-500)
- Reference: Optional but recommended for tracking

Error Handling¶
Common HTTP Status Codes¶
| Code | Meaning | Description |
|---|---|---|
| 200 | OK | Request successful |
| 400 | Bad Request | Invalid request format or parameters |
| 401 | Unauthorized | Invalid or missing API credentials |
| 403 | Forbidden | Insufficient balance or IP not authorized |
| 429 | Too Many Requests | Rate limit exceeded |
| 500 | Internal Server Error | System error, contact support |
| 503 | Service Unavailable | System temporarily unavailable |

Retry Logic¶
Implement exponential backoff for failed requests:
- Network errors: Retry with backoff (1s, 2s, 4s)
- 429 Rate Limit: Wait 60 seconds before retry
- 500/503 Errors: Retry with backoff (5s, 10s, 30s)
- 400/401/403 Errors: Do not retry, fix the request
Rate Limits & Security¶
Rate Limits¶
| Endpoint | Limit | Window |
|---|---|---|
| General API | 300 requests | 15 minutes |
| Top-up endpoints | 200 requests | 1 minute |
Rate Limit Headers:
Daily Transaction Limit¶
- Maximum: 5,000 MXN per 24-hour period
- Prevents excessive spending
- Resets automatically at midnight UTC
